This SANYO microwave oven has a limited warranty covering manufacturing defects for 1 year on labor and parts.
Setting Clock: Press SET WEIGHT/SET CLOCK, turn Rotary Dial for hour, press SET WEIGHT/SET CLOCK, turn Rotary Dial for minute, press SET WEIGHT/SET CLOCK.
Child Lock-Out: Press and hold STOP/CANCEL for 3 seconds to set. Press and hold for 3 seconds to cancel.
Microwave Time Cooking: Turn Rotary Dial for time, press POWER LEVEL to set power, press START.
Quick Start: Press START to begin immediately. Repeatedly press START to add 30-second intervals up to 12 minutes.
Auto Menu: Turn Rotary Dial for menu (A1-A9), press SET WEIGHT/SET CLOCK, enter quantity/weight, press START.
Defrost: Press DEFROST (once for Meat, twice for Poultry, three times for Fish), turn Rotary Dial for weight, press START.
Grill: Press GRILL, turn Rotary Dial for time, press START.
Combination Cooking (Combo 1 & 2): Press COMBO 1 or COMBO 2, turn Rotary Dial for time, press START.
| TROUBLE | POSSIBLE CAUSE | POSSIBLE REMEDY |
|---|---|---|
| Oven will not start. | • Electrical cord for oven is not plugged in. • Door is open. • Wrong operation is set. |
• Plug into the outlet. • Close the door and try again. • Check instructions. |
| Arcing or sparking. | • Materials to be avoided in microwave oven were used. • The oven is operated when empty. • Spilled food remains in the cavity. |
• Use microwave-safe cookware only. • Do not operate with oven empty. • Clean cavity with wet towel. |
| Unevenly cooked foods. | • Materials to be avoided in microwave oven were used. • Food is not defrosted completely. • Cooking time, power level is not suitable. • Food is not turned or stirred. |
• Use microwave-safe cookware only. • Completely defrost food. • Use correct cooking time, power level. • Turn or stir food. |
| Overcooked foods. | • Cooking time, power level is not suitable. | • Use correct cooking time, power level. |
| Undercooked foods. | • Materials to be avoided in microwave oven were used. • Food is not defrosted completely. • Oven ventilation ports are restricted. • Cooking time, power level is not suitable. |
• Use microwave-safe cookware only. • Completely defrost food. • Check to see that oven ventilation ports are not restricted. • Use correct cooking time, power level. |
| Improper defrosting. | • Materials to be avoided in microwave oven were used. • Cooking time, power level is not suitable. • Food is not turned or stirred. |
• Use microwave-safe cookware only. • Use correct cooking time, power level. • Turn or stir food. |
